There is also a recipe for homemade ornaments (I think it uses cinnamon, btw I got some last week walmart 50 cents Spice classic brand) the dough isn't too hard to work with. We made them and the ornaments have lasted over 10 years! You can paint the dough, we used sequins on some and painted a gloss finish on them! We stuck a paper clip thru them right away before they'd dry and that is the hook. This is something that could be done on thanksgiving break, keeps them busy awhile, then you let them dry and could hang them up before they go back to class on Mon. or Tuesday!
